Malika Rural Municipality is one of the 6 municipalities in Myagdi District of Gandaki Province. As per the 2021 census, the rural municipality has a total population of 18,332, comprising 8,867 males (48.4%) and 9,465 females (51.6%), with a literacy rate of 77.89%. Spanning 147.0 square kilometers, Malika Rural Municipality exhibits the population density of 125 people per square kilometer. Administratively, it is divided into 7 wards.

According to the latest publicly available report of the Center for Education and Human Resource Development (CEHRD), Malika has 35 schools. Of these, 3 are private and 32 are public. The breakdown includes 20 pre-schools, 35 basic schools, and 8 secondary schools. Among the secondary schools, 3 offer +2 programs.
